Dead tree removal services involve the careful removal of dead, decaying, or diseased trees from residential, commercial, and public properties. These services typically include assessing the tree’s health and stability, safely cutting down the tree, and removing the debris from the site. The process often requires specialized equipment and techniques to ensure the tree is taken down without causing damage to nearby structures, landscapes, or power lines. Professionals may also offer stump grinding or removal as part of the overall service to clear the area completely.
Dead or dying trees can pose significant problems if left untreated. They may become unstable and threaten to fall, risking property damage or personal injury. Additionally, decaying trees can attract pests or become a source of disease that affects surrounding healthy vegetation. Removing hazardous trees helps maintain the safety of the property and prevents potential liabilities. It also improves the aesthetic appeal of the landscape by eliminating unsightly, decaying wood and clearing space for new plantings or construction projects.

Tree Removal Cost - The typical cost for dead tree removal ranges from $200 to $1,000, depending on the tree's size and location. Smaller trees may cost around $200 to $500, while larger, more complex removals can reach $1,000 or more.
Labor Expenses - Labor fees for dead tree removal generally vary between $75 and $150 per hour. The total labor cost depends on the tree's height, accessibility, and the complexity of the job.
Equipment and Disposal Fees - Additional costs for equipment and debris disposal can add $50 to $300 to the overall price. Heavy-duty equipment or challenging sites tend to increase these expenses.
Factors Affecting Price - Costs may fluctuate based on tree location, size, and potential hazards. For example, trees near structures or power lines often incur higher removal fees due to safety considerations.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
